What are the most common structural weaknesses in lightweight landscape chairs?

Lightweight landscape chairs are popular for their portability and modern design, but they often suffer from structural weaknesses that compromise durability. The most common issues include:

1. Weak Frame Joints: Many lightweight chairs use plastic or thin metal joints that loosen or crack over time, especially under frequent use.

2. Thin Leg Supports: Slim legs may bend or snap when exposed to uneven surfaces or excessive weight.

3. Material Fatigue: UV exposure and weather conditions can degrade plastic or aluminum frames, leading to brittleness.

4. Unstable Backrests: Chairs with minimal bracing often wobble or collapse if leaned back too far.

5. Poor Weight Distribution: Overloading one side can cause premature stress fractures in the seat or legs.

To avoid these problems, opt for chairs with reinforced joints, thicker gauge materials, and rust-resistant coatings. Regular maintenance, like tightening screws and storing chairs indoors during harsh weather, can also extend their lifespan. Investing in high-quality designs ensures both comfort and longevity for outdoor seating.
